Is Online Gambling Legal in Your Country?

Online Gambling

There are many different forms of online gambling. Some of them include casinos, sports betting, virtual poker, and lottery games. While each of these is legal in some countries, they are illegal in others. Whether or not a particular form of online gambling is legal in your country will depend on state law.

A number of legal disputes have arisen over the implementation of federal gambling laws. In many of the cases, a challenge has been made on constitutional grounds. These concerns have included questions of legislative power and the Commerce Clause.
